What do you mean by leadership?

Leadership is the ability of an individual or a group of individuals to influence and guide followers or other members of an organization. ... In business, individuals who exhibit these leadership qualities can ascend to executive management or C-level positions, such as CEO, CIO or president.

What is needed in a leader?

Skills Good Leaders Need. There are a number of broad skill areas that are particularly important for leaders. These include strategic thinking, planning and delivery, people management, change management, communication, and persuasion and influencing.

What is the leader role?

A leader's most important role is to provide clear and compelling direction. ... Leaders ensure that all followers understand, embrace, and work toward achieving those objectives. And they provide momentum, sharing and celebrating progress toward achieving company goals, setting new targets, and providing needed resources.

What is a strong leader?

Strong leadership is when you can encourage, motivate, inspire and challenge your team to produce their best work. Strong leadership connects a team together through a common purpose and builds relationships in the workplace that allow for effective communication, more creativity and better problem-solving skills.
